21 June 2008 - Join us in celebrating the AA's 50th Birthday at the Union Pub in Marylebone, London. The AA was formed on 21 June 1958 at 19:22 GMT (20:22 BST) in London. Join us for a casual get-together to reminisce about the first 50 years of the AA. All members and supporters are invited to come along from 7pm to the Union Pub at 88-90 George Street, London W1U 8PA.

Kepler Day Research Conference

Kepler Day Research Conference, Saturday 22 November 2008
The Social Sciences and Humanities investigate the value of astrology and
its future. This year's Kepler Day Research Conference will take place on
Saturday 22 November 2008, 10:00-17:00, at Connaught Hall, 36-45 Tavistock Square, London WC1H 9EX. It is being organised and sponsored by the Sophia Centre, University of Wales, Lampeter, the Research Group for the Critical Study of Astrology and the Astrological Association. The conference is a forum for research in astrology in the humanities and social sciences, with speakers and discussion. Further details about the programme and booking information to be announced.
